i know that the piggyback is supposed to increase overall performance -- but lets say you have a few mods installed, some of which may increase your midrange and high end, but take away from the low end. would the piggyback help to regain some low end or even it out? I guess that's the whole point, but just wanted to make sure my understanding of how it all worked was clear

thanks!
the pig widens and strengthens the overall powerband... so for most mods for our car, its not too much about hp or tq numbers, (still important) but how much power is available throughout the rpms... the piggy really gets after the problem of a week range of power and gets us more power pretty much everywhere... one thing u will notice right away is the throttle response. its So much better, specially at high speeds. i have the magnum bore rail so i mean its kickin *** for me now. i touch the gas and i can feel acceleration much more quickly than before..


the pig also maximises what u can accomlish from bolt ons, by putting them to better use, it capitalizes onall the mods.. sort of like the icing on the cake, by leaningout the fuel and therfore even making ur gas meilege better. although it does take 89+ octane fuel to own knock. (right? )
